Stiftungsfest is a "Founder's Day" celebration held in Norwood Young America, Minnesota, United States, on the last full weekend of August every year. The first Stiftungsfest was held in 1861.[1] It is Minnesota's oldest celebration.
The Stiftungsfest highlights the German heritage of the city. It features old-time and polka bands from across the United States and Germany as well as ethnic food.[2]
